Wildlife in Khorasan Razavi Province in photo-1

Khorasan Razavi Province, in northeastern Iran, is home to a mountain of natural attractions including conservation areas, wildlife sanctuaries, and a national park.

Khorasan Razavi Province has one national park, three national natural monuments, three wildlife sanctuaries and 21 protected areas. Those preserves, home to a wide diversity of fauna, give the province a special place in the country’s natural environment.
